The two secret ingredients that gave this dish it’s extra pop of flavor was the bay leaf and splash of lemon juice. The bay leaf gives the white rice extra flavor, while the lemon juice helps bring out more of that citrusy lime taste. Now, most cilantro lime rice does not call for green onion, but for myself it is a must have, giving this side more texture and beautiful flavor complimenting every component. Serve this dish at room temperature or as a cold side to any gathering for a side that will please a crowd.
- 1 cup uncooked white rice
- 1 dried bay leaf
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 2 limes
- 2 teaspoons of lemon juice
- ¼ cup chopped cilantro
- ½ cup chopped green onions
- Salt/ pepper
- Add the bay leaf and salt to your rice and water
- Cook white rice according to direction keeping it on the firm side
- Immediately when done cooking rice remove from heat and add olive oil, salt and pepper
- Set rice aside for about 15 minutes to cool
- While rice is cooling chop cilantro and green onions
- Add to the rice lime juice, lemon juice, cilantro, green onion and mix
- Test the seasonings and adjust if needed
- Serve immediately or refrigerate
- Enjoy warm or cold
